RE: ENQUIRY INTO THE RUNNING AND RIDING OF “CHARLIE” (DRAWN 8) RUN IN RACE NO.21 – THE IBRAHIM A. RAHIMTOOLA TROPHY (DIST. 1200 MTRS) ON 4TH DECEMBER 2022 :

 

Trainer Vinesh and Jockey Vikram Jodha were questioned on 9th December 2022 into the captioned matter.

 

Trainer Vinesh stated that his instructions were to sit in 3rd, 4th or 5th position and to start improving from 800 metres thereafter, turning for home to come from the outside and to do his best. On being asked for his observations of the race trainer Vinesh stated that while the Jockey had made an effort to get into position as instructed however in the straight, he had drifted out thus losing ground and thereafter his riding in the final furlong was weak and attributed it to Jockeys caliber. It was pointed out to him that he had declared a jockey of his choice and to question the jockey’s competence is not acceptable.

 

Jockey Vikram Jodha having confirmed the riding instructions stated that he has ridden the horse from the word-go and in the straight, the gelding had shifted out under the whip which he had immediately corrected. On being asked about his efforts in the final furlong he stated that he has done his best and added that this may be his 3rd or 4th ride after a long gap.

 

The Stewards of the Club at their meeting held on 18th December 2022, having heard the submission made by Trainer Vinesh and Jockey Vikram Jodha and also having viewed the race in question. The Stewards of the Club, decided to caution both Trainer and Jockey.

RE: ENQUIRY INTO THE RUNNING AND RIDING OF “SUSSING” (DRAWN 4) RUN IN RACE NO.31 – THE SPORTS EX CONSULTANCY TROPHY- DIV-II (DIST. 1400 MTRS) ON 11TH DECEMBER 2022 :

 

Trainer H. J. Antia and App. A. S. Peter were called in and questioned on 14th December 2022 into the captioned matter.

 

On being asked, trainer H. J. Antia stated that his instructions were to settle and do his best in the straight and when asked what it meant by settle he stated that he instructed the apprentice to sit 3rd, 4th or 5th position.

 

Apprentice A. S. Peter having confirmed the instructions stated that the mare was hanging in, in the straight and also does the same during morning work.

 

On being asked for his observation Trainer H. J. Antia stated that the mare has a tendency to lean in (hang-in)

The race in question and the previous race of the mare were viewed.

 

On being questioned with regards to the change in the running pattern the trainer stated that considering that the mare would weaken in the final furlong when she raced well up he had decided to try and settle her and come from behind.

 

The Stipendiary Stewards were not satisfied with the explanation tendered by both the trainer and jockey in that the trainer has changed the pattern of running thereby placing the mare at a disadvantage and as for the Apprentice he has not ridden out the mare in the straight, further, the statement of the apprentice with regards to the mare hanging in could not be borne out in the video recordings.

 

The Stewards of the Club at their meeting held on 25th December 2022, having heard the submissions made and viewed the race in question as also the previous races of the mare and decided to fine Trainer H. J. Antia Rs.10,000/- for unsatisfactory running and Apprentice A. S. Peter has been suspended for two race days i.e. on 15th and 21st January 2023 (permitted to ride work/mock race) for unsatisfactory riding.
